The official music video was released on October 21, 2018. "Goodbye" samples " Time to Say Goodbye" by Italian opera singer Andrea Bocelli. It features on Guetta's album 7 as track number six. Meanwhile, Minaj and Derulo first collaborated in 2010 when she featured on the remix to his single " In My Head", taken from Derulo's debut self-titled studio album. In 2017, they released the collaboration " Light My Body Up" (also featuring Lil Wayne). In 2015 they collaborated on " Hey Mama" (also featuring Bebe Rexha and Afrojack) for his sixth album Listen (2014). Guetta and Minaj have previously collaborated four times, beginning in 2011 with " Where Them Girls At" (also featuring Flo Rida) and " Turn Me On", both taken from Guetta's fifth album Nothing but the Beat. "Goodbye" is a collaboration with US R&B singer Jason Derulo and features Trinidadian-American rapper Nicki Minaj, as well as French musician and DJ Willy William. On August 24, 2018, Guetta unveiled the sixth and seventh singles from his seventh album 7 (2018), "Goodbye" and then also "Drive" (with Black Coffee featuring Delilah Montagu). It is the sixth single from Guetta's 7 album and was unveiled alongside another single from Guetta called "Drive" with Black Coffee and featuring Delilah Montagu. The song debuted on 23 August 2018, and was released a day later by both Guetta and Derulo's record labels – What a Music, Parlophone, Beluga Heights and Warner Bros. "Goodbye" is included on Guetta's seventh studio album, 7 (2018). The latter three are credited due to the inclusion of elements of their composition " Time to Say Goodbye", as performed by Sarah Brightman and Andrea Bocelli. It was adapted and written by Guetta, Philippe Greiss, William, David Saint Fleur, Art Beatz, Curtis Gray, Jean-Michel Sissoko, Dj Paulito, Jazelle Rodriguez, Christopher Tempest, Kinda Ingrosso, Minaj, Derulo, Francesco Sartori, Lucio Quarantotto and Franck Peterson.
" Goodbye" is a song by American singer Jason Derulo and French DJ and music producer David Guetta featuring vocals from Trinidadian rapper Nicki Minaj and French recording artist Willy William.
